directions

  • Oven Temp ~ 350° Baking Time ~ 50 minute.
  • Preheat oven.
  • Line your cake tin (3 inches tall) with greaseproof or other non-stick paper and grease the tin.
  • Melt chocolate pieces with butter over hot water.
  • Beat together the eggs and sugar, mix in flour, cocoa powder, baking powder and vanilla extract.
  • Slowly fold in the melted butter and chocolate mix along with the sour cream.
  • Bake at suggested temperature until a wooden pick inserted in center comes out clean.
  • Cool the cake.
  • FROSTING. Heat the heavy cream or whipping cream in a sauce pan, stirring so that it does not burn. Do Not Boil.
  • Remove from heat, add semisweet chocolate pieces, stir until smooth, and let it cool until in thickens.
  • Frost the cake.
  • Put the cake into the fridge for one hour or more to harden the frosting. This cake should be room temperature when served.
